What are the differences between the Skyland and the SA? I know the technical stuff but which one is more "valued" by the collectors? I have been leaning towards the Skyland. Which is the more expensive also?

Marcos, the prices are right about the same. One is a larger diameter which is what people tend to flock towards. Most dealers have a harder time keeping the SA's on the shelves, though I have no idea how many of each are produced.
